Here’s an idea on how to solve this, which I do agree is a problem. I’ve seen aholes that do this too many times.
Receive “X” (where X might == 2, 4, 6??) team mate kills and you can not drive a vehicle for the rest of the (or maybe multiple) game (s). Basically it won’t allow you to get in the Drivers seat of any vehicle so you can kill again.
Each time they try to get in, they also get a message on screen telling them “Bad Drivers lose their License”, or something similar.
I like it. It’s a pretty fair response that shouldn’t punish genuine mistakes too harshly.
